To become a software engineer, there are several formal education steps that one can take. These steps typically include the following: Earn a Bachelor's Degree: The majority of software engineers have a Bachelor's Degree in Computer Science or a related field, such as computer software engineering or information technology. Software engineers need at least a bachelor’s degree in software engineering, computer science, information technology, or a related field. For more senior roles or management positions, employers may require significant experience in the role or a master’s degree. The timeline to become a principal software engineer varies, but typically takes 10 to 15 years of progressive software engineering experience. This journey involves moving through entry-level, junior, and senior positions while honing technical and leadership skills to become the ideal candidate.
